Petco is a category-defining health and wellness company focused on improving the lives of pets, pet parents and Petco partners. We are 29,000 strong and operate 1,500+ pet care centers in the U.S., Mexico and Puerto Rico, including 250+ Vetco Total Care hospitals, hundreds of preventive care clinics and eight distribution centers. We’re focused on purpose-driven work, and strongly believe what’s good for pets, people and our planet is good for Petco.
PetcoLoveis an independent 501(c)(3) non-profit organization dedicated to supporting lifesaving animal welfare work in communities across the country. Since 1999, PetcoLovehas harnessed the power of donations madeatPetco stores across the country to invest $430million in animal welfare organizations.Withthousands ofanimal welfare partners, PetcoLoveinspires and empowers communities to make a difference by investing in petadoption andlifesaving initiatives.We’vehelpednearly71million pets find loving familiesand reunitednearly171,000lost pets with their families through Petco Love Lost.
Reporting to theLead, Creative,theMultimediaand Visual CommunicationsSpecialistisacreative thinker and multi-taskerwho knows howtomove quickly to capture andtellengagingvisualstories.
TheSpecialistwillbe responsible forconcepting/storyboarding, shooting, and editing photo and video content for web and social platformsthat drive engagement and support team KPIs.Bringingnew ideasto the table to help uscontinuouslytest and improve.
Responsibilities includeshootingand editingvideography and photography;coordinating,sourcing, and managing freelance photo and video shoots nationwide; video editing using Adobe Premier, After Effects, and social editing tools;light animation for graphics and text;and management of creative assets.
Theyshouldpossessa "newsroom" mentality (fast-paced, quick turnaround),andadeep understanding ofsocial media, staying tapped into best practices and social trends.
They’lltellstories in the Petco Love voice that help people feel inspired and emotionally connected to our work and our brand.
They should be comfortable developingandproducingcreative content across multiple platformsthatinspiresviewers,helpsdistinguish ourbrandandcompelsindividuals todonateand amplify our message
The ideal candidate willbe a gifted storyteller andhaveproventrack recordengaging people on various platforms throughexceptional editorialstorytellingskills.
A background incapturing and editing photo and videoandstrongcommunicationskills are essential
TheSpecialistwill be expected toleveragedigital tools,technologyand platforms to enhance theirstorytellingand connect withPetco Love’saudienceThey should have experience using social networksand have a strong understanding of what content is engaging on these platforms and be able toidentifyandleveragetrends
The role will include social creative conceptand strategydevelopment,photo and video editing, asset coordination, and content-related project management.
